Proper cuticle care is an essential part of every professional nail service. It supports healthy-looking nails, creates a clean surface for product application and helps achieve a neat, long-lasting finish.
The cuticle is a thin layer of non-living tissue attached to the nail plate. It forms part of the nail’s natural protective barrier, helping to prevent dirt and bacteria from entering the nail area. Cuticle preparation should therefore focus on carefully removing excess non-living tissue without damaging the surrounding living skin.
Every client’s nail and skin are different. Cuticle condition may be affected by:
- Cold weather, heat and low humidity
- Frequent hand washing and sanitising
- Exposure to water or cleaning chemicals
- Picking, biting or pulling the skin
- Incorrect or overly aggressive nail preparation
-
Naturally dry or sensitive skin
Assessing the area before beginning will help you choose the correct tools, pressure and technique for each client.

Cuticle Preparation
1. Assess
Check the nail plate and surrounding skin for dryness, sensitivity, excess tissue, damage or signs of irritation. Do not continue with the service if the area appears infected or unsafe to work on.
2. Apply Lola Lee Cuticle remover to the excess cuticle, allow the Cuticle Remover to soften the cuticles (30-60 seconds) before pushing them gently.
3. Gently push back
Use a cuticle pusher with light, controlled movements to expose the nail plate and loosen non-living tissue. Avoid unnecessary pressure and never force the tool into the surrounding skin.
4. Remove excess tissue
Carefully remove tissue attached to the nail plate while keeping the tool flat against the nail. Only trim loose, non-living skin when necessary, using clean, sanitised cuticle scissors or nippers.
5. Remove the Cuticle Remover
Using a nail Lola Lee Nail Wipe and Lola Lee Sani Liquid remove the Lola Lee Cuticle Remover thoroughly.
6. Prepare the nail plate
Lightly buff the nail where required, taking care not to thin or damage the natural nail. Remove all dust and cleanse the surface with a Lola Lee Nail Wipe and Lola Lee Sani Liquid.
7. Hydrate with Lola Lee Cuticle Oil
Once the service is complete, apply Lola Lee Cuticle Oil to nourish the surrounding skin and maintain flexibility. Encourage clients to use it regularly between appointments for the best results.

Homecare
Lola Lee Cuticle Oil should be used at least once per day or applied as often as you need to.
It is best to apply Lola Lee Cuticle Oil every night.
Salon
Lola Lee Cuticle Oil should be applied once you have completed your Lola Lee Gel Polish application.
If you are applying nail polish you can either apply the cuticle oil once you have prepped the natural nails before you apply Lola Lee Nail Polish, but be sure to remove all excess oil on the nail plate before applying your Lola Lee Nail Polish.
You can also apply the Lola Lee Cuticle Oil when you have completed the Lola Lee Nail Polish application, but be very careful not to smudge the newly painted nails.
Soak-Off
When you are soaking off your gel polish it is advised to apply Lola Lee Cuticle Oil around your nail before you soak them off, this will protect and nourish the skin around your nail and prevent the skin from drying.
